EC 1.1.1.184 [carbonyl reductase (NADPH)] inhibitor
CHEBI:CHEBI_73136
Definition
An EC 1.1.1.* (oxidoreductase acting on donor CH-OH group, NAD(+) or NADP(+) acceptor) inhibitor that interferes with the action of carbonyl reductase (NADPH), EC 1.1.1.184.
